Anambra Candidates Cry Out Over Registration Challenges as 2025 DE Deadline Nears

Candidates from the South-East region, particularly Anambra State, have raised serious concerns about difficulties in completing their Direct Entry (DE) registration ahead of the approaching deadline.

One candidate, Chukwuka Chidalu, sent a heartfelt appeal to the JAMB management, describing the situation as frustrating and urgent.

“No Network,” Unapproachable Officials – Candidates Complain

According to Chukwuka, many DE candidates trying to register at the Amawbia centre in Anambra have been unable to complete their registration due to persistent network issues.

“They keep saying no network and it’s almost deadline,” Chukwuka wrote.
“Please come to our aid. The officials you put in Amawbia centre are so inhumane and not approachable.”

Chukwuka added that many candidates are now fearful that they might miss the registration deadline through no fault of their own.

JAMB Urged to Intervene

Candidates are calling on JAMB to urgently investigate the situation at the Amawbia centre and deploy immediate solutions to ensure no candidate is unfairly denied the opportunity to register.

Past Experiences Raise Concerns

This is not the first time candidates have complained about network problems, overcrowding, and poor treatment at some centres, particularly during registration deadlines.

While JAMB has made efforts to automate and improve registration processes, the feedback from centres like Amawbia suggests that more hands-on supervision may be needed, especially in highly populated areas.
